Ingredients
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 5 large onions, peeled and thinly sliced
- sea salt and black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on ground turmeric
- 1/2 teaspoon fenugreek seeds
- 1/2 teaspoon dried mint
- 2 tablespoons plain flour
- 700 ml vegetables or 700 ml chicken stock
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 1 lemon, juice of
- 1 teaspoon caster sugar
- 3 flat leave parsley sprigs, coriander

Instructions
Heat 2 tbsp olive oil, the onions and some seasoning. Cover and seat for 12-15 minutes until the onions are soft, lifting the lid and stirring occasionally.
Add the spices, dried mint and remaining oil, then stir in the flour, cook, stirring frequently, for 3-5 minutes.
Gradually pour in stock, whisking as you do so to prevent any lumps forming.
When it has all been added, drop in the cinnamon stick and simmer over a low heat, partially covered with the lid, for 30-40 minutes.
Stir in the lemon juice and sugar, then taste and adjust the seasoning. Discard the cinnamon stick. Ladle the soup into warm bowls and scatter over the herbs to serve.
